RDNL

Chelsea Hulm will join Kyneton for the Riddell District Netball League season. Hulm joins the Tigers from Casterton-Sandford in the Western Border Netball League, where she quickly made GA her home. During her time there, Hulm collected multiple best and fairest awards, runner-ups, and a young achiever award. She has also represented her club at state titles, playing for Glenelg and the South Australian Country Championships.

Bendigo FL

Four Gisborne players have been training with Victorian Football League clubs for the upcoming season. Shane Clough, who played with Essendon’s VFL side last season along with Matt Merrett, James Gray and Dylan Johnstone are either training with Essendon or the Footscray Bulldogs squads. “Three of these boys have come up through the Gisborne Rookies pathways, and we are exceptionally proud of the partnership we have built with our junior club,” Gisborne Football Netball Club said on social media.

VNL

The Victorian Netball League season will get underway on 11 March. Matches will be played across 17 venues in 2026 with all 12 clubs to host home games. The Western Warriors will kick off their season against the North East Blaze at the State Netball Centre in the usual Wednesday night time slot. The Warriors’ will play at their home court, Cobblebank Stadium, on 29 March and Geelong Cougars on 24 May.

Softball

Action in the Sunbury Softball Association competition resumed on Saturday. In the women’s competition, the Calder Dragons beat Reservoir Rats, 14-3 while the Goonawarriors and Macedon Vixens had a 4-4 draw. Highlights included, Paris Latimer of the Goonwarriors hitting a grand slam and Rachel Bromley almost making a home run off of Danielle Baxter’s pitch but was tagged out at home base. In the men’s competition, the Goonwarriors beat the Calder Dragons 9-2 and the Rat Pack smashed the Outlaws, 37-7.
